Transaction c35a23068427fd763dde1d15a1c56b12231de33478426783e599d9c70f10de87
1 Input
2 Outputs
- c35a23068427fd763dde1d15a1c56b12231de33478426783e599d9c70f10de87:0
- c35a23068427fd763dde1d15a1c56b12231de33478426783e599d9c70f10de87:1
value 6033
address 37iQ34F2bzkxfnkPvWh2CUurDhx2gRguSe
value 58949837
address 1GTLHyuGsHouo2gvA8iXXK77DmBhqxHesw